Yard Waste and 4/50 Collection Guidelines
Broward County > Solid Waste And Recycling Services > Unincorporated > Yard Waste and 4/50 Collection Guidelines

 

Yard waste will be collected on your bulky waste collection days only. Follow these guidelines to ensure collection.

Note: These items will be collected on your bulky waste collection day only.

  • Loose material such as grass clippings, leaves, etc. must be placed your green garbage cart for regular pick up or in a tied plastic garbage bag for bulky waste collection.
  • Bags must weigh less than 50 pounds when full.
  • Cut and bundle tree trimmings, branches, palm fronds, etc. Bundles must not exceed 4 feet in length and 50 pounds in weight (4/50 Rule).
  • Tree trunks, logs and large limbs too big to be bundled, must be cut smaller than 4 feet and weigh less than 50 pounds. Items must be stacked neatly at the curb.
  • Keep yard waste separated from regular bulky waste items for easier collection.
  • Stack yard waste in orderly piles on the swale (away from mailboxes, trees, fire hydrants, storm drains and other bulky waste piles).
  • Remember, the (4/50 Rule) applies to items placed out for bulky waste collections.
